NAVSTAR 52 (USA 168)

    NORAD ID: 27704
    Int'l Code: 2003-010A
    Perigee: 19,736.9 km
    Apogee: 20,641.3 km
    Inclination: 53.4°
    Period: 718.0 min
    Semi major axis: 26,560.1 km
    Launch date: March 31, 2003
    Source: United States (US)
    PRN: 21
    Comments: Navstar 52, also known as USA 168 and as GPS 2R-9, is an American Global Positioning Satellite that was launched by a Delta 2 rocket from Cape Canaveral AFS at 22:09 UT on 31 March 2003. It will replace the aging GPS 2-5 in the fleet (of 28 satellites).
